We are bringing our Mit fridge over, but we r changing to a bigger washer and a dryer from the "WANT" list.

After much research, we decide on F & P washer cos Asian top load washer quite high energy consumption. 6kg using 350W to 400W, front loader an astonishing 2000W... :jawdrop: F & P using direct drive technology= save lots of energy, 200W for a 8.5kg, jus dat if motor breaks down wil cost more for parts, but they r giving 5 years warranty for motor :thumbs up: . Currently we are doing 6 to 8 loads a week, so changing to a 8.5kg or 10 kg will lessen the no of wash. This happens when u have kid(s), we do 2 loads a week jus his clothes and beddings! F & P products lasts quite long too, got friends whose F &P fridge is 12+ years, washer 10+ yrs too. We r still deciding on gas dryer by Rinnai or F & P electric one, costs about the same but gas dryer only comes in 5 kg load...... :dunno:
